C#

Помогите с авторизаций в с#, скиньте какой нибудь код разберусь

Вот
Евгений Васильков
Евгений Васильков
1 212
Лучший ответ
Кайрат Есетов чувак, можешь не отвечать мне, я это для себя делаю
 using System; 

class Program
{
static string storedUsername = "admin";
static string storedPassword = "password";

static void Main()
{
Console.WriteLine("Введите имя пользователя:");
string username = Console.ReadLine();

Console.WriteLine("Введите пароль:");
string password = Console.ReadLine();

bool isAuthenticated = (username == storedUsername) && (password == storedPassword);

Console.WriteLine(isAuthenticated ? "Успешная авторизация!" : "Неверное имя пользователя или пароль.");
Console.ReadLine();
}
}
Авторизация:
private void L_Enter_Click(object sender, RoutedEventArgs e)
{
if (L_Pass_P.Visibility == Visibility.Visible)
{
if (Sub.Login(L_Lodin.Text, L_Pass_P.Password) == true)
{
StartTest st = new StartTest();
st.Show();
this.Hide();
}
else MessageBox.Show("Ошибка ввода логина или пароля!", "Ошибка входа");
}
else if (L_Pass_T.Visibility == Visibility.Visible)
{
if (Sub.Login(L_Lodin.Text, L_Pass_T.Text) == true)
{
StartTest st = new StartTest();
st.Show();
this.Hide();
}
else MessageBox.Show("Ошибка ввода логина или пароля!", "Ошибка входа");
}
}

private void Button_Click(object sender, RoutedEventArgs e)// кнопка открытия пароля.
{
if (L_Pass_P.Visibility == Visibility.Visible)
{
string pass = L_Pass_P.Password;
L_Pass_T.Text = pass;

L_Pass_T.Visibility = Visibility.Visible;
L_Pass_P.Visibility = Visibility.Hidden;
}
else if (L_Pass_T.Visibility == Visibility.Visible)
{
string pass = L_Pass_T.Text;
L_Pass_P.Password = pass;

L_Pass_P.Visibility = Visibility.Visible;
L_Pass_T.Visibility = Visibility.Hidden;
}
}
private void R_Reg_Click(object sender, RoutedEventArgs e)
{
if((R_Surname.Text.Length > 0) && (R_Name.Text.Length > 0) && (R_Login.Text.Length > 0) &&
(R_Pass_1.Text.Length > 0) && (R_Pass_2.Text.Length > 0))
{
if (Sub.RegexPass(R_Pass_1.Text) == true)
{
if (R_Pass_1.Text == R_Pass_2.Text)
{
//if (Sub.Registration(R_Login.Text, R_Pass_1.Text, R_Surname.Text, R_Name.Text, R_Patronymic.Text) == true)
// MessageBox.Show("Регистрация успешна!", "Ура!!!");
//else MessageBox.Show("Ошибка занесения данных в базу данных", "Ошибка регистрации");

//MessageBox.Show(Sub.Registration(R_Login.Text, R_Pass_1.Text, R_Surname.Text, R_Name.Text, R_Patronymic.Text).ToString());
if (Sub.Registration(R_Login.Text, R_Pass_1.Text, R_Surname.Text, R_Name.Text, R_Patronymic.Text) == "Ok")
{
MessageBox.Show("Удачно");
}
else MessageBox.Show("Данный логин уже используется, пожалуйста выберите другой!", "Ошибка регистрации");
}
else MessageBox.Show("Пароли не совпадают!", "Ошибка регистрации");
}
else MessageBox.Show("Пароль должен быть не менее 6 символов!", "Ошибка регистрации");
}
else MessageBox.Show("Не все поля заполнены ((", "Ошибочка");
}
}
}